Durchmesser. Zur Anwendung kommt dabei die sogenannte Formstrahltechnik, bei der durch die elektronen-optische Abbildung zweier Blenden beliebige Rechtecke und 45\u00b0 Dreiecke mit einer Abmessung von maximal 2 \u00b5m x 2 \u00b5m auf einmal belichtet werden k\u00f6nnen. Diese Technik erm\u00f6glicht, in Verbindung mit &bdquo;Write-on-the-fly&ldquo; und Vector Scan, eine im Vergleich zu Punktstrahlschreibern deutlich schneller Belichtung von orthogonalen und diagonalen Strukturen. Andersartig geformte Strukturen werden entsprechend angen\u00e4hert belichtet. Zus\u00e4tzlich ist das System mit der sogenannten Zellprojektion ausgestattet. Damit k\u00f6nnen auch komplexere Designbl\u00f6cke mit einer maximalen Ausdehnung von 2 \u00b5m x 2 \u00b5m im Block belichtet werden.
